Dizzy Gillespie's incorporation of Latin rhythms and styles into modern jazz was one of his primary achievements (second only perhaps to his technical innovations in the bebop vocabulary). When Gillespie added conguera Chano Pozo to his orchestra in the late 1940s, he helped establish a template for Afro-Cuban jazz in the U.S. LATINO: ANTHOLOGY 1947-1957 covers Diz's output with his orchestra during this influential period. In addition to covering jazz classics in Latinized style ("A Night in Tunisia," "Caravan"), Gillespie and Co. add their own classics to the canon with "Cubana Bop," "Manteca," and others. The jazz icon's spectacular trumpet playing and band leadership make these dense, danceable, and always fun recordings shine.
